Second flush teas from Assam are known for their distinctive malty flavor. This black tea acquires the same malty traits along with the gorgeous golden tips that make it stand out from the rest. Robust malty flavors interlaced by the delectable notes of brown dates and dried raisins hum throughout the entire duration of the cup. Briefly interrupted by the hints of cocoa, the experience finishes on stone-fruity flavors akin to apricots, making it a sublime cup of summer black tea.

taste
A full-bodied, brisk cup which opens with robust malty flavors interlaced with delectable notes of brown dates and dried raisins. These flavors hum along throughout; interrupted briefly by subtle hints of cocoa; which shore up around the edges. Muted woody textures is discernible towards the end; which however ebb to finish on exquisite stone-fruity flavors akin to apricots - adding a layer of depth and rounded feel to the cup. The mellow character lingers on, making for a memorable cup of Assam orthodox black tea.
